Tertiary alkyl halides give:

Correct answer: A. SN1 and E1 reaction

  • A. SN1 and E1 reaction
  • B. SN2 and E2 reaction
  • C. SN2 and E1 reaction
  • D. None of the above

Explanation

Tertiary alkyl halides have three R groups attached, and hence experience a high stearic hindrance. That is why the attack of nucleophile is difficult and hence they proceed by SN1 in 2 steps. They give SN1 and E1 reactions.

About Alkyl Halides

Alkyl halides are named and related to their carbon-halogen structure, polarity and reactivity. The key reactions are nucleophilic substitution by SN1 and SN2 mechanisms and elimination by E1 and E2 mechanisms, including how substrate structure, nucleophile, base, solvent and temperature influence substitution versus elimination.
